Betty Sue Loeffler born March 30,1939 passed away peacefully on February 8, 2025. Born in Russellville, AL, but spent her life in Mobile and on Dauphin Island. She attended Murphy High School, and spent her time in a life of service afterwards. Working in dental practice until retirement, she continued by volunteering her time with Rotary Rehab of Mobile Infirmary. Betty spent 67 years married to the love of her life, Bo Loeffler. They built a beautiful life in Mobile and on Dauphin Island. Family times together at Dauphin Island were amongst her most cherished memories. She loved an early morning line pull from a speckled trout, and cooking breakfast for everyone afterwards. Betty was an angel on earth. Family was always her first priority, and she spent her life showing others what it meant to be selfless. She was preceded in death by her husband Bo, mother, father, and brother.
